## Releases

Greyfen pins every dependency to an exact version; ranges are not permitted. Upgrades go through a dedicated pinning PR reviewed by two maintainers, and the lockfile is treated as the source of truth. After merging, tag the release and produce a signed bundle, since the Talwick registry refuses unsigned uploads. The release signing key maintainers should use is:

release key, fahaf-bajof: bky3_Xam

Team,

The cut-over to the new comparator in ReportForge's report builder finished last night. Sorting is now guaranteed stable: rows with equal keys preserve their source order, which fixes the intermittent reordering in grouped exports that Marla flagged during the Quillhaven pilot. We backfilled the regression suite with three tie-heavy fixtures, and the legacy comparator path is fully removed, so there is no fallback to re-enable. For future maintainers, the exact settings the service now runs with are listed below.

service settings:
PRAIX_LOG_LEVEL=error
PRAIX_METRICS_HOST=metrics.praix.qorvelcorp.corp
PRAIX_POOL_SIZE=16

## 2.4.1 — Key Rotation

Exports from the Lanternby report service now render timestamps in the workspace timezone instead of UTC, fixing off-by-one-day totals in daily summaries. As part of this release we rotated the export-signing credentials; old exports remain valid but new ones require the key below.

deploy key for kajof-fajop: bky6_gDHw9Q

Leadership Review Briefing — Inventory Write-Down

For the board: Merrow Industrial will record a write-down on obsolete Caltrix-series stock held at the Fenbrook warehouse. Estimated impact is 2.1% of quarterly earnings. Root cause: demand forecasts not updated after the Caltrix redesign. Controls have been revised, and disposal of remaining units is underway. No restatement of prior periods is required. Strategic implications are set out in the confidential note below.

board note of hahaf-fahog: The pricing group signed off on a budget of $229.3 million for Project Aldius.